Reese Witherspoon Pays Emotional Tribute To James Van Der Beek As His Final Role In “Elle” Takes On New Meaning

Reese Witherspoon has broken her silence following the death of James Van Der Beek, sharing a heartfelt tribute as fans prepare to see what will now be remembered as one of his final performances.

Van Der Beek died Wednesday after battling colorectal cancer since August 2023. He had filmed scenes last year for “Elle,” the upcoming Legally Blonde prequel series, marking his last television role.

Reese Witherspoon Says She Is “Devastated”

Witherspoon, who serves as an executive producer on “Elle,” shared an emotional message on her Instagram Stories after learning of his passing.

She described herself as “devastated” by the news.

“What an extraordinary, talented man who also showed great kindness and grace in every action,” she wrote alongside a portrait of the late actor.

She also added, “Praying all the angels watch over his family during this difficult time.”

Her tribute quickly resonated with fans, many of whom remembered Van Der Beek not only for his on screen presence but also for his reputation as a thoughtful and dedicated performer.

James Van Der Beek’s Final TV Role In “Elle”

The upcoming Amazon Prime Video series “Elle” will follow Elle Woods during her high school years, serving as a prequel to the original Legally Blonde films that made Witherspoon a household name.

Van Der Beek portrays Dean Wilson in the series, described as the city’s new mayoral candidate and current school district superintendent. His appearance was intended to be a nostalgic and meaningful addition to the expanding Legally Blonde universe.

Now, the role carries added emotional weight.

The series is set to premiere July 1 on Amazon Prime Video, and for many viewers, it will serve as a final opportunity to see Van Der Beek in a new project.

An Outpouring Of Love From Co Stars And Friends

Following news of his death, former co stars and longtime friends have publicly shared tributes.

Kerr Smith, who appeared alongside Van Der Beek on Dawson’s Creek, wrote that he was grateful to call him a brother and would miss him deeply.

Busy Philipps also shared a heartfelt message, expressing deep sorrow not only for those who worked with him but especially for his wife Kimberly and their six children.

The actor was widely known for his breakout role in Dawson’s Creek before transitioning into a diverse range of television and film projects over the years.

Kimberly Van Der Beek Shares Emotional Statement

James’ wife, Kimberly, confirmed that he “passed peacefully.”

She said he met his final days “with courage, faith, and grace,” and asked for privacy as the family grieves.

The couple had been married for 15 years and shared six children: Olivia, Joshua, Annabel, Emilia, Gwendolyn, and Jeremiah.

Friends have since organized a $500,000 GoFundMe campaign to help the family, citing financial strain caused by the extensive medical care required during his cancer battle.

According to the fundraiser page, the family is working to remain in their home and provide stability for the children during this difficult period.
